4. A Quote for the DBAs….
“As a Database Administrator (DBA) your skills, services,
expertise and ultimately your time will always be in demand.
You can only ever deliver on a finite amount of time, that’s just
the way it is, so it’s incredibly important that you maximize the
use of the time you have available. Herein lies the secret of
automation and it’s compounding interest that it pays to the
DBA. The more tasks, systems and processes that you can
automate, the more time you have available to proactively
reinvest in tasks that add value to your business and to you.”
- John Sansom
Microsoft Certified Master (MCM) of SQL Server

8. Who is
looking for
YOU?
REGION ROLE DESCRIPTION
(Contained the word SQL)
GAUTENG Available Jobs: 1 548
Salary Range: R15k – R100k
KZN Available Jobs: 143
Salary Range: R10k – R45k
WESTERN CAPE Available Jobs: 745
Salary Range: R12k – R85k
Total 2 436
9. Meet your
Competition
REGION CANDIDATES
(CV contained the word SQL)
GAUTENG No of Candidates: 9 013
Av years experience: 4
Av salary: R46k/mnth
KZN No of Candidates: 1 1 89
Av years experience: 2/3
Av salary: R21k/mnth
WESTERN CAPE No of Candidates: 1 596
Av years experience: 4
Av salary: R37k/mnth
Total 11 798

16. How to make your
CV stand out:
• Think of your CV as a Sales Tool
• Make sure your CV makes an early impact
• Be clear & structured – do not waffle
• Tailor your CV to the role you want
• Avoid fabrications
• Make your key skills stand out
• Proofread to make sure there are no
spelling / grammatical errors
• Update your LinkedIn Profile at the same
time
17. Some common SQL Interview
Questions
• Are you a problem solver?
• Do you know the primary responsibility of a
DBA?
• What do you know about Database Backups?
• Why do you want to be a DBA?
• Can you provide quality examples of your
previous projects?
• Do you have a basic grasp of the Relational
Model?
